Painting was a gift to my Mom. It appears in good to very good shape. Looks like original frame. I searched the internet and found that Runci painted "Calender Girls: in the 50's and his wife was a Graphic Artist in Los Angeles. Her name was Maxine, so it seems that this is a portrait of his wife. 

Signature on front right hand corner of canvas: "Runci"

Hand-writing on back of canvas reads:

1st line - Painted 1957 - only one

2nd line - Maxine (Mrs. Edward) Runci

3rd line in quotations - "Invitation"

Stamp on canvas frame:

ALL REPRODUCTION RIGHTS RESERVED BY ARTIST

Signed: Edwaed Runci is hand written
